Deutsche Bank’s Descartes Systems DSGX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$24.7M Buy
243,112
+7,083
+3% +$720K 0.01% 774
2025
Q1
$23.8M Buy
236,029
+105,238
+80% +$10.6M 0.01% 779
2024
Q4
$14.9M Sell
130,791
-2,013
-2% -$229K 0.01% 908
2024
Q3
$13.7M Buy
132,804
+24,664
+23% +$2.54M 0.01% 925
2024
Q2
$10.5M Buy
108,140
+26,459
+32% +$2.56M ﹤0.01% 985
2024
Q1
$7.48M Buy
81,681
+2,349
+3% +$215K ﹤0.01% 1115
2023
Q4
$6.67M Hold
79,332
﹤0.01% 1136
2023
Q3
$5.82M Sell
79,332
-65,985
-45% -$4.84M ﹤0.01% 989
2023
Q2
$11.6M Buy
145,317
+10,265
+8% +$822K 0.01% 933
2023
Q1
$10.9M Buy
135,052
+7,402
+6% +$597K 0.01% 941
2022
Q4
$8.89M Buy
127,650
+64,440
+102% +$4.49M 0.01% 996
2022
Q3
$4.02M Buy
63,210
+59,823
+1,766% +$3.8M ﹤0.01% 1295
2022
Q2
$210K Sell
3,387
-279
-8% -$17.3K ﹤0.01% 3111
2022
Q1
$269K Buy
3,666
+509
+16% +$37.3K ﹤0.01% 3065
2021
Q4
$261K Sell
3,157
-350
-10% -$28.9K ﹤0.01% 3205
2021
Q3
$285K Sell
3,507
-700
-17% -$56.9K ﹤0.01% 3342
2021
Q2
$291K Buy
4,207
+559
+15% +$38.7K ﹤0.01% 3533
2021
Q1
$222K Sell
3,648
-8,277
-69% -$504K ﹤0.01% 3550
2020
Q4
$697K Sell
11,925
-18,471
-61% -$1.08M ﹤0.01% 2667
2020
Q3
$1.73M Buy
30,396
+5,797
+24% +$330K ﹤0.01% 1832
2020
Q2
$1.3M Buy
24,599
+14,511
+144% +$767K ﹤0.01% 2053
2020
Q1
$348K Buy
10,088
+4,093
+68% +$141K ﹤0.01% 2656
2019
Q4
$256K Buy
5,995
+5,794
+2,883% +$247K ﹤0.01% 3037
2019
Q3
$8K Sell
201
-446,070
-100% -$17.8M ﹤0.01% 4315
2019
Q2
$16.5M Sell
446,271
-14,352
-3% -$530K 0.01% 1057
2019
Q1
$16.8M Sell
460,623
-119,040
-21% -$4.33M 0.01% 1082
2018
Q4
$15.3M Buy
579,663
+176,237
+44% +$4.66M 0.01% 1039
2018
Q3
$13.7M Sell
403,426
-3,662
-0.9% -$124K 0.01% 1388
2018
Q2
$13.2M Buy
407,088
+17,110
+4% +$556K 0.01% 1504
2018
Q1
$11.1M Sell
389,978
-2,436
-0.6% -$69.5K 0.01% 1529
2017
Q4
$11.1M Sell
392,414
-39,865
-9% -$1.13M 0.01% 1404
2017
Q3
$11.8M Buy
432,279
+5,299
+1% +$145K 0.01% 1328
2017
Q2
$10.4M Buy
426,980
+58,020
+16% +$1.41M 0.01% 1369
2017
Q1
$8.45M Buy
368,960
+246,136
+200% +$5.64M 0.01% 1364
2016
Q4
$2.63M Buy
122,824
+47,442
+63% +$1.02M ﹤0.01% 2058
2016
Q3
$1.62M Buy
75,382
+5,464
+8% +$117K ﹤0.01% 2466
2016
Q2
$1.33M Buy
69,918
+54,543
+355% +$1.04M ﹤0.01% 2657
2016
Q1
$299K Sell
15,375
-10,129
-40% -$197K ﹤0.01% 3389
2015
Q4
$511K Sell
25,504
-39,459
-61% -$791K ﹤0.01% 3192
2015
Q3
$1.15M Buy
64,963
+57,400
+759% +$1.01M ﹤0.01% 2815
2015
Q2
$121K Sell
7,563
-39,700
-84% -$635K ﹤0.01% 3933
2015
Q1
$710K Buy
47,263
+42,830
+966% +$643K ﹤0.01% 3043
2014
Q4
$64K Buy
4,433
+59
+1% +$852 ﹤0.01% 4613
2014
Q3
$60K Sell
4,374
-600
-12% -$8.23K ﹤0.01% 4389
2014
Q2
$70K Buy
4,974
+4,074
+453% +$57.3K ﹤0.01% 4435
2014
Q1
$12K Buy
+900
New +$12K ﹤0.01% 4844
2013
Q4
Sell
-200
Closed -$2K 4954
2013
Q3
$2K Buy
+200
New +$2K ﹤0.01% 4976